"Glenn Mitchell Collision Estimator" Manual section dated 1969, used by Body shops to estimate repair costs and also to provide part numbers for parts ordering to complete repairs.  Today, it's very useful to ID used or NOS parts as well as finding the correct OEM part numbers for use in your Restoration Parts shopping.  11 pages, showing diagrams and locations of parts, along with the original Ford part number for each application and model.  Covers front bumper and sheetmetal, front compartment and trim, Cooling and fan, including special parts 8 cyl engine packages, including the 6 cyl,  260, 352, 390, and 406, accessories such as Pulleys, mounts and similar bolt-ons,  Fenders and Trim, Cowl and Dash, Windshield and Wipers, Front Suspension, Wheels, steering systems, body and doors, Rear panels, Glass, Rear moldings, sheetmetal, and bumpers, Rear suspension, Engine and cooling, Electrical, Air Conditioning, Exhaust, Rear lamps, Station Wagon Parts, Convertible top,  and more.  A great asset for your restoration library, as it is old enough to provide the original part numbers prior to the changes and drops that occur in the FOMOCO parts books as each new edition is released.
